#!/usr/bin/ksh
#
# Surveillance des process de Mailhub
#
# 05/12/96   ESO-12151/R.CLAUDON
#
# 06/04/1999 - S. GISLAIN modification processus
#
fic_tmp=/tmp/ps.opc.mailhub
n_tot=0

#liste de tous les process a superviser 
# PROCESS='mhsqd dsaauto.protDUARC dsaauto.DUARC GDS processInbndMsgs tsapd queueWatcher AdminServer cometd checkMailhub'
PROCESS='mhsqd GDS processInbndMsgs tsapd queueWatcher AdminServer cometd checkMailhub DUA\-dsaautoprotected DUA\-dsaautopublic'

for i in $PROCESS
do
    ps -aef | grep $i > $fic_tmp.$i
    grep $i $fic_tmp.$i
    if [ $? -eq 0 ]
    then
        n_tot=`expr $n_tot + 1` 
    fi

    rm $fic_tmp.$i
done

/opt/OV/bin/OpC/opcmon ESO_MAILHUBProc=$n_tot
